Step-by-step explanation:

Given  : 6 x 89.

To find: Use properties to find the sum or product

Solution : We have given  6 x 89.

We can write 89 as ( 100 - 11)

So ,  6 x  ( 100 - 11) .

Using distributive property. a ( b - c ) = a *b - a *c .

6 x 100 - 6 x 11.

600 - 66 .

534

Therefore, 534.
